

Living on the beach, playing a game and cashing in on a cool $40,000…what more could a Magic fan ask for?
Mark Herberholz defeated Craig Jones 3-2 in the finals of Pro Tour-Honolulu, capping a fantastic debut to the 2006 Pro Tour season. Herberholz came out to Hawaii a few days early from dreary Michigan to hang out with a bunch of other Pros in a house on the North Shore, and now he's a Pro Tour champion!
A fabulous location, a massive Pro Tour, a dramatic Top 8 - with perhaps the greatest topdeck in Magic history - a fevered fan might not know where to start.

But how about seeing Herberholz, a three-time Top 8er, strike gold with his aggressive Gruul Beats deck? He thrashed Osyp Lebedowicz in the quarterfinals, and then smoothly dispatched Tiago Chan to make the finals against Jones. Moldervine Cloak paved the way for Heezy against the Professor, depositing a huge check into Herberholz's bank account.
Jones's path to the finals was much more dramatic as he personally took on the Ruel brothers, Magic's reigning royal family. Antoine Ruel had no chance against Jones in the quarterfinals thanks to possibly the worst deck matchup of all time.
Olivier, however, battled back from a 2-1 deficit to put Jones on the brink of elimination before the fates turned on him in the semifinals. Jones needed a burn spell to save himself, and up came Lightning Helix ! The crowd roared, Jones celebrated and Olivier's hopes were dashed against the rocks of topdeck tragedy.
We hope you enjoyed Pro Tour-Honolulu as much as everyone here did. Congratulations to Mark Herberholz and all the players, and we'll see you again at Pro Tour-Prague on May 5-7.

FINAL TOP 8 STANDINGS
1. Mark Herberholz [USA] | $40,000 | |
2. Craig Jones [ENG] | $22,000 | |
3. Tiago Chan [PRT] | $15,000 | |
4. Olivier Ruel [FRA] | $14,000 | |
5. Osyp Lebedowicz [USA] | $11,500 | |
6. Maximilian Bracht [DEU] | $11,000 | |
7. Ruud Warmenhoven [NLD] | $10,500 | |
8. Antoine Ruel [FRA] | $10,500 |
